(In reply to Till Hofmann from comment #1)
The upstream versioning stream definitely looks broken, they assume
that
0.61 < 0.7.
Maybe this should be changed downstream to 0.6.1? Of course, proper upstream
versioning would be ideal.
I know, so far normal releases have been numbered 0.x, development releases
0.x9 and bugfix releases 0.x1. I told them to switch to semantic versioning or
something that makes sense starting with the 1.0 release.
